Ohio State added the first player to its 2021 recruiting class Sunday night when Convoy Crestview power forward Kalen Etzler announced his commitment to the Buckeyes on Twitter.

The Convoy, Ohio native is listed as a four-star prospect and the No. 51 overall recruit of the 2021 class by 247Sports.

“A special thank you to Coach Holtmann, Coach Pedon and the rest of the OSU staff for investing time in me and having the confidence to move forward together,” Etzler said in his Twitter announcement.

Standing at 6-foot-8 and 195 pounds, Etzler will add size and length to the Buckeye frontcourt.

The No. 2 recruit in the state, Etzler also had offers from Bowling Green, Miami (OH), Duquesne and Iowa.

Holtmann landed the No. 31, No. 57 and No. 59 recruits in his 2019 class with DJ Carton, E.J. Liddell and Alonzo Gaffney, and has yet to sign a top 60 recruit for 2020.
